Chapter 403 Securing The Core

403 Securing The Core

"Let's see whose side fate will take," A deep voice sounded in the calm of the spacious chamber.

After receiving the message, Alex returned to the palace, and now he was seated face-to-face with the collector, a man who was an anomaly without question.

Tragus belonged to the undead race, a bony figure standing 8.6ft tall, exuding an imposing and formidable presence, with Luminous eyes that emitted a cold glow, and a battle staff was firmly held in his grasp.

He had a pulsing green rune etched onto his slightly exposed chest, and as for his attire, he wore an ancient Regalia, two dark pauldrons covering his shoulders, and a dark cape made from some scaly draconic skin.

Alex felt like none of his secrets were hidden before the luminous green eyes, and the featureless face of the undead that conveyed every emotion without moving only added to the mystery and horror that permeated the surroundings of the enigmatic figure before him.

Alex saw him as an anomaly not because of his strength or presence but because of the strange way he talked, as for the last ten minutes that they had spent face to face, he had multiple stage statements while not even answering back to his greetings.

The statements ranged from Haha, so he did not lie, A grand Abyse, Chosen, A Chosen with a burden like a mountain, a strong will, weak, very weak but a seed of problem, anomaly, cunning monkey, wasteful could be wasteful.

Alex understood nothing, as every statement seemed random yet also profound and filled with meaning, and they appeared to be connected to him yet shrouded in an enigmatic veil that defied comprehension.

The guardians beside him also understood nothing, and after saying nonsense for ten minutes, he finally said something that made it clear he was back to his senses.

"It looks like the trip was worth it," Tragus said, his bony face showing no emotion, yet Alex could tell he was happy.

"Boy, I will give you the Core of Alistair, and in return, I want a favor from you without any restriction, with the sole condition being that it will not harm you or the people you care about," Tragus said, as a small crystallin box appeared on his hand and placed it on the table.

'What?' Alex questioned as he looked at Tragus's luminous eyes, failing to understand why he was giving away something so valuable for a single favor.

The same was the reaction of his guardians, yet it was not because the ask was cheap, but they were surprised at the audacity of Tragus for making such an unfair offer.

As a Ruler, Alex had access to things that only he could acquire, and while he himself didn't realize it at the moment, Tragus could ask him to acquire something from the Ruler shop, which could cost him vastly more than the core of darkness or even the seed of renewal would have costed him.

"I will not ask him to buy some rare artifact from the Ruler shop," Tragus said, knowing what everyone was thinking.

"What do you intend to use the favor for? I'm aware you've already had something planned," Varon questioned.

"I can't disclose that information, and before you propose that my request should be of equal value to the core and nothing more, save your breath because I won't agree to such terms."

"The duration of the favor and the extent of my requests are non-negotiable."

"My ask will only need to meet the agreed-upon requirements, and that's the extent of it," Tragus said, his luminous eyes unwaveringly fixed on Alex.

By now, Alex had grasped that the offer held a little benefit for him as he would be bound to do a certain thing, and while there were pretty tight requirements in place, he knew better than to underestimate the old monster who would undoubtedly exploit it to his advantage.

Alex couldn't understand what Tragus could use the favor for, as his best value was his status as a Ruler, and with the request not being valid if it harmed him or the people he cared about, that didn't leave any real ways he could he exploited.

"If your demand will not do any financial, physical, spiritual, or psychological harm to the Domain Ruler and those he holds dear, then we can make a deal," Varon said after a moment of silence and received a head nod from Tragus.

'Domain Ruler, it's important to note that while Tragus never engages in deals that result in direct losses, his interpretation of profit and loss deviates significantly from conventional understanding.'

'The primary concern with this favor lies in the time period, as I am certain he will wait a long time before he comes to collect it.'

'Despite the strict restrictions preventing calamitous requests, if the prospect of owing him a favor makes you uncomfortable, it's best to refrain from accepting this deal.' Varon said telepathically, leaving the final decision to Alex.

Alex understood that Varon was comfortable with the deal and was leaving the final decision to him, so he had nothing to worry about, and without delay, he voiced his agreement to the deal.

"Boy, It was a pleasure doing business with you," Tragus said, extending his bony hand for a handshake.

Alex shook the giant bony hand while having fleeting thoughts that he had just been scammed, yet the happiness of acquiring the core overwhelmed such thought, as his mind was busy calculating the immediate benefits.

Tragus left shortly after the deal was made, and the following moments were of celebration as Elder Ana?lle thanked him for his help and made a promise to repay him to the best of her abilities when she ascended to the state of Mother World Tree and also pledging eternal allegiance as an ally.

Alex was given three Platinum-grade System Wishes and a staggering 12 billion galactic coins on the completion of the mission's first stage, which was surprising as he received no rewards after saving the Human Emperor.

After a moment of thought, Alex didn't find it surprising as the rewards he received were not even listed, and the true rewards would be given to him when Elder Ana?lle truly became the Mother World Tree, and the Dryad Race and their Empire were revived.

However, Alex was over the moon with the rewards as the three Platinum-grade wishes could greatly help in the upcoming turbulent times.

Elder Ana?lle also became emotional as she held the core of her brother, and after minutes of silent grievance, she shared her plan to return to her mother continent, the Verdant Pyre.

A continent located not far from the Domain, a jungle continent with Beasts as its Ruler, it housed the world's biggest volcano and the remnants of the once towering Mother World tree.

Alex would have liked to visit it with Elder Ana?lle, but there was nothing for him there, as Elder Ana?lle would need years to make her transformation and decades to grow to a similar level as her mother.

After half an hour, Alex said goodbye to Elder Ana?lle after she introduced him to Ruellia Aldoris, the matriarch of the Royal Dryad clan living in the domain, and Jazarius Faras, the patriarch of the Darkling clan.

The Darklings were humanoid creatures standing seven feet and some inches on average, with pointy ears much longer than elves, angular pointy chins, and, at a glance, looked a little different from the present-day Dark Elves.

It would be more accurate to say that dark elves looked like them as they were their descendants, and after their introduction, both figures not only pledged their eternal loyalty to him but also offered their complete support with any of his desires.

After a final goodbye, Elder Ana?lle left for the Verdant Pyre continent, while Alex, happy with how things, returned to the wilderness to continue with his hunting and training.

The following two weeks went by without any major events besides clashing against beasts and monitoring the organization's affairs from time to time, he did nothing else.

Alex planned to return to the human continent to deal with the demon cult once his Mana body was fully formed and was reaching near his stat limits, which should be done in six or so weeks.

After two weeks, Alex himself was contacted by Guild Leader Hecate of the Ravenglades Guild, informing him that she had located a Zaratan turtle that came to the surface only amid a raging storm in the Black Ocean.

She believed it was the place along with the Tomb of Dragon Monarch Oberon, and Alex himself didn't need to think twice to know it was the place.

Hecate shared how she would certainly truly appreciate and even compensate if the organization could help her reach the Tomb, and he consented to go along with her, knowing the treasures awaiting in the tomb.

They decided to meet on the Human Continent in three weeks, and now looking forward to an adventure, Alex himself returned to his own daily routine routine.
